5 V; N% N* d1 } 1.STRUCTURAL SYSTEM DESCRIPTION
6 g/ }* j5 F6 d! ` ?- ?2 Z6 A The goal of the Burj Dubai Tower is not simply to be the world’s highest building; it’s to embody the world’s highest aspirations. The superstructure is currently under construction and as of summer 2007 has reached over 135 stories. The final height of the building is a ‘well-guarded secret’. The height of the multi-use skyscraper will ‘comfortably’ exceed the current record holder of the 509 m(1671 ft) tall Taipei 101. The 280 000 m2 (3 000 000 ft2) reinforced concrete multi-use tower is utilized for retail, a Giorgio Armani Hotel, residential and office.
